香港服务器MySQL工作原理全解析
为何要了解香港服务器MySQL的工作原理?
在数字化需求激增的今天,企业与个人对数据存储管理的要求日益提升。香港服务器凭借地理位置优势(覆盖亚太用户低延迟)和网络稳定性,成为许多用户的选择。而MySQL作为全球广泛使用的开源关系型数据库管理系统(类似数字仓库,按表分类存储数据),常被部署于香港服务器。理解其工作原理,能帮助用户更高效地操作数据库,减少使用中的常见问题。
MySQL基础:数字仓库的“房间”与规则
简单来说,MySQL是一个结构化数据管理工具。用户可将订单、用户信息等不同类型数据存入“表”(类似仓库的独立房间),并通过SQL语句实现查询、新增、修改、删除等操作。当MySQL部署在香港服务器时,其运行效率受服务器硬件(如至强CPU)、网络延迟等因素影响,这也是其被广泛选择的核心优势之一。
香港服务器MySQL的运行全流程
第一步:建立连接——打开数据仓库的“门”
以小型电商运营人员为例,若需查看商品销售数据,需先通过数据库管理工具(如Navicat)连接香港服务器上的MySQL。用户输入服务器地址、账号密码后,请求会发送至MySQL服务端。这一过程类似用钥匙开门:服务端验证身份信息(账号密码是否匹配),验证通过则建立连接,用户获得操作权限。
第二步:解析查询——告诉仓库管理员“找什么”
连接成功后,用户输入“查询上月某类商品销量”的SQL语句,如“SELECT COUNT(*) FROM sales WHERE category='文具' AND date BETWEEN '2024-01-01' AND '2024-01-31'”。MySQL接收到语句后,会先解析语法(确认语句格式正确),再分析目标表(sales表)和查询条件(时间、商品类别),同时调用索引(类似仓库物品清单)快速定位数据大致位置,避免全表扫描浪费资源。
第三步:执行查询——从“仓库”取数据
解析完成后,MySQL根据索引定位到硬盘中的具体数据存储位置,开始读取。若数据量较大(如百万条记录),系统会优化读取策略(如分批加载),提升效率。读取后,还会根据查询条件过滤、排序数据(如仅保留1月的文具销售记录),确保返回结果精准。
第四步:返回结果——呈现最终“物品”
处理完成的数据会被打包成结果集,通过香港服务器的低延迟网络传输回用户端。用户在Navicat等工具中即可看到“上月文具销量:1234件”等具体结果,整个过程通常只需几秒。
实际操作与常见问题应对
通过Navicat等工具可直观演示上述流程:输入香港服务器IP、账号密码连接MySQL,编写SQL语句并执行,实时查看连接状态、查询耗时等信息。若遇到连接失败,可检查网络是否稳定、账号密码是否输入错误;若查询速度慢,可能是未合理使用索引(可通过“EXPLAIN”命令分析查询计划)或数据量过大(建议分表存储)。
掌握香港服务器MySQL的工作原理,能让用户更灵活地利用服务器性能优势,无论是日常数据查询还是高并发场景,都能实现更高效的数据库管理,为业务决策提供可靠数据支撑。
上一篇: 美国服务器运维降本5大实战技巧
下一篇: 香港VPS Linux合规认证解析